Lukashenko: Belarus ready for most intensive co-operation with Venezuela

The Republic of Belarus is ready for the most intensive co-operation with Venezuela – as noted by President Aleksandr Lukashenko during his today’s meeting with the Vice President for Planning and Minister for Planning of Venezuela, Ricardo Jose Menendez Prieto

photo: www.president.gov.by

Welcoming the guest, Aleksandr Lukashenko noted, “I am happy to meet you. We know each other for a long time. You know Belarus well. We started from scratch during the life of our mutual friend, Hugo Chavez. We have done a lot, and it is not our fault, it is not the fault of Belarus and Venezuela that there has been a certain pause in our relations. Our relationship has been in place, though not very intense. Fortunately, we have not lost the areas that were identified earlier in our co-operation. Moreover, the most important point that I would like to tell you is that we are ready for more intensive, the most intensive co-operation with Venezuela. You are aware of our capabilities, and you need them – including technologies, and and more. It is time to start.”

Aleksandr Lukashenko expressed hope that, during the current visit of the Vice President of Venezuela, the parties will determine what the restoration of bilateral co-operation should start with.

“I think we should involve the programmes that we previously defined. Everything is topical. Nicolas Maduro, the President of Venezuela, was present and actively participated in the formation of the programmes that have been preserved by now. I want to emphasise once again: everything that we proposed at that time, everything that we planned is in demand for Venezuela… Therefore, I think we need to conduct an audit of all our projects – add something or exclude the points that are irrelevant today from our action plans. We should update the roadmap that we jointly outlined earlier,” the Belarusian leader added.
